Listen..... I grew up reading Wattpad and Fanfiction.net
I can suspend my beliefs for a great number for fictional plot lines.
What I can't get passed is the girls being abused almost daily and still being physically attracted to their abusers!!
The violence again the main female characters in this series is both concerning and abhorrent. It concerns me that there are younger women being disillusioned by this book into being attracted to abusive characters because 'theyre just so hot'. Very difficult to get through because the bullying is so severe.
Sure, use fairy dust to travel dimensions, that's no problem with me, but can we have a little dignity for the main characters?? Hard to believe it took 2 authors to put this piece of work together.....
Spoiler Alert: there's literally a c-plot concerning murder and in the A-plot they are worried about a fucking school dance, I'm not making this up.
I think this series yanked me out of my adult 'romance' novel phase.... Like even Fifty Shades was more fleshed out😶🌫️
I HATED a crown of thorns and roses and it was still better than this.
